Chapter 15 (1861-1865): Crucible of Freedom: Civil War Mobilizing For War -Both North and South were unprepared for war. -North had a small army of sixteen thousand men, mostly in the West. -One-third of the Union officers resigned to join the Confederacy. -No strong president since James Polk and Lincoln was viewed as a ?yokel? -Union -The federal government had levied no direct tax structure -Never imposed a draft. -Confederacy -No tax structure -No navy -Two tiny gunpowder factories -Poorly equipped -Unconnected railroad lines. -Recruitment and Conscription -Largest army organization created in America -2 million in Union -800,000 in Confederate -Recruitment depended on local efforts than national or state.
